800kV Ultra HVDCYunnan - Guangdong
World‘s first 800kV Bulk Power Ultra HVDC Transmission System
China Southern Power Grid Commercial OperationPole 1 - December 2009Pole 2 - June 2010
±800 kV DC - 1418 km - 5000 MW
Reduction in CO2: 32,9 m tons p.a.by using Hydro Energy & HVDC transmission vs. local Power Supply with Energy mix

HVDC PLUSTrans Bay Cable Project
First HVDC PLUS installation
400 MW Active Power±170 MVAr Reactive Power~88 km submarine cable±200 kV DC230 kV / 138 kV, 60 Hz

Grid Access – HVDC PLUS & WIPOSBorWin2 and HelWin1 Projects
WIPOS is designed as a floating, self-lifting platform.
The Platform will be towed by tugs to its destination at sea, where the Water is about 40 meters deep.
A large heavy-duty crane vessel is not required to lift the topside onto its foundation.
The HVDC PLUS technology reduces complexity and space required for installation.
BorWin2World‘s first VSC HVDC with 800 MW, 300kV DC
